How do bugs get into sealed packages?

How Do Bugs Get In Sealed Containers? Most often, pests use their sharp jaws to make tiny punctures and sneak into cardboard or plastic containers. … If the pests don’t chew their way into packages, they will most likely slip through tiny openings.

How do you stop weevils?

How to prevent weevils in the pantry. If you have room in your freezer, place items such as flour, grains, cereals and pulses in freezer bags and place the items in the freezer for a minimum of four days. This will kill any eggs that may be present in the produce.

What food has bugs in it?

Most dried food products can be infested by insects

  • Cereal products (flour, cake mix, cornmeal, rice, spaghetti, crackers, and cookies)
  • Seeds such as dried beans and popcorn.
  • Nuts.
  • Chocolate.
  • Raisins and other dried fruits.
  • Spices.
  • Powdered milk.
  • Tea.

Is it true that peanut butter has bugs in it?

It’s true. There are bugs in your peanut butter, but the FDA clearly states that you’re only eating their parts. The government’s official Defect Levels Handbook notes an allowed ratio of 30 insect fragments per 100 grams of yummy spreadable.

What does a weevil look like? Weevils are small insects, typically around 0.25 inch (6 millimeters). They range in color from black to reddish-brown. Weevils are usually cylindrical or pear-shaped. Since there are so many species of weevils and corresponding families, and subfamilies, there’s a wide range in shape and color.

How do you get rid of a weevil infestation?

Eliminate Grain Weevils

  1. Discard any infested foods. …
  2. Vacuum pantry shelves, cracks, and crevices.
  3. Wipe shelves with white vinegar.
  4. Dispose of garbage and vacuum bags outside, away from the home.
  5. Check regularly for reappearance — it may take awhile to get rid of them completely.

What causes weevils in rice?

Weevils usually infest grains and starches like rice, flour, pasta, and cereals. Weevil infestations that start outside may be the result of fruit trees or gardens, which are also food sources. The insects often gather on the sides of homes and move into cracks and gaps that lead inside.

Do weevils carry disease? Rice and granary weevils are harmless to people, houses, furniture, clothing and pets. They cannot bite or sting and they do not carry diseases. They will not feed on furniture, the house structure or other items. The harm they do is destruction of the seeds they infest and the annoyance of being in the wrong place.
